Hocheggersattel | 1318 METER | Oberwölz Oberzeiring
The Hocheggersattel, at an altitude of 1,318 metres, is situated in the Wölzer Tauern. The road is ideal for a leisurely drive. It is gently winding, runs straight through wooded areas on the eastern slope, and offers some lovely views down into the Wölzbacher Valley on the western side.
The Gellsee lies right at the top of the pass. It is situated within a protected moorland and nature reserve, around which a popular moorland nature trail also runs.
A little to the west of the pass summit, near the well-known Hochegger Wirt or Sagmeister inn, a narrow farm track branches off towards Salchau, offering scenic views. It also leads to Wölz; it is about three kilometres shorter but more challenging to drive.
There is an enduro park along the route.
For a longer motorbike tour, the beautiful but certainly challenging Sölk Pass is ideal in the west, whilst in the east there is the “Triebener Tauern” Alpine pass, which is relatively easy to ride.
